J.B. Smoove shares the amazing story behind how he landed the role of Leon Black on ‘Curb Your Enthusiasm,’ now set to return for a long-awaited ninth season.

Larry King: Did Larry David spot you for Curb? Did he know you?

JB Smoove: I didn't know Larry.
Larry King: You auditioned?
JBSmoove: That story is fabulous, man. It's too long to tell. But my wifedid tell me I was going to be on Curb Your Enthusiasm. I was watchingthe show one day. And I said, "I love this show, baby. I would love tobe on that show one day." She said, "You're going to be on that show oneday. Because you say crazy stuff all the time. And I think you andLarry would be so fabulous together." Buddy passes away in LA. I didn'tget -- things had to happen. I didn't get renewed for SNL, my buddypasses away in LA. I come to LA for one day --- one day. I fire myagent, I fire my manager, I got rid of everybody. I come back in town,to LA, one day for a memorial service for my buddy. Got my new agent tosay hi to him, said he had an audition for Curb Your Enthusiasm. I said,"Wow." I get there, I meet Larry for the first time. I told Larry thisis my favorite show. We kicked it at the audition, we hit it off fromthe get go.
Larry King: Wow.
JB Smoove: And I leftthere, my agent called me, I said, "Anybody else gets that show besidesme? God bless 'em. But we had a good time. And lo and behold.
Larry King: You got it.
